Qatar Stock Exchange Index Falls 0.06 Percent

The QSE index closed at 9,851.49 after losing 5.84 points. Trading volume reached QR 391.5 million across 26,833 transactions.
The Qatar Stock Exchange index closed lower on Wednesday. It dropped 5.84 points, or 0.06 percent, to end the session at 9,851.49.
Traders exchanged 140,698,123 shares during the day. The total value of these trades was QR 391,511,719.344. These activities spanned 26,833 individual transactions.
Sector performance shows mixed results
Stock prices moved in different directions across the board. Twenty-one companies saw their share values increase. Thirty companies recorded a decline in their stock prices.
Two companies remained unchanged from their previous closing levels. This split indicates a lack of broad market consensus on direction. Investors displayed cautious behavior in this session.
Market capitalization decreases slightly
The total market capitalization stood at QR 594,078,407,480.286. This figure is lower than the previous session. The prior closing valuation was QR 594,843,657,863.070.
